Ground Report | New Delhi: Renaming Rajiv Gandhi Khel; Shiv Sena has slammed the BJP-led central government for renaming India's highest sports award. The party, in its mouthpiece 'Saamana', has accused the central government of doing politics and keeping revenge and animosity. The Central Government last week renamed the Rajiv Gandhi Khel Ratna Award as Major Dhyan Chand Khel Ratna Award.

Saamana wrote in its editorial, "Major Dhyan Chand could have been respected without insulting the sacrifice of Rajiv Gandhi. India has lost that tradition and culture. Today Dhyan Chand must be feeling the same."

He further wrote, "Today at a time when the whole country is celebrating the golden hour of India's performance in the Tokyo Olympics, the central government has played a political game. Many people are hurt because of this sport."

In its editorial, Saamana has made a direct attack on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Home Minister Amit Shah. He has written that the government has claimed that the decision to change the name has been taken under the public sentiment, but there is no dispute about it because Congress also used to do the same.

Saamana wrote, "Amit Shah's words are 100% correct. There is no point in arguing on his statement because in the last 70 years the Congress governments have done what was done by Nehru, Gandhi, Rao, Manmohan, Morarji, Deve Gowda, Gujral, Chandrashekhar. The work has been done to make the works shine." He further wrote, "Governments are not run by revenge and malice, and this is also a public sentiment which should be taken care of."

Raising further questions on the name change, Shiv Sena further wrote, "BJP political players are saying that did Rajiv Gandhi ever take hockey in his hand? The question is reasonable, but when Narendra Modi changed the name of Sardar Patel Stadium in Ahmedabad. But if kept, did he also do something amazing in cricket. And when the stadium in Delhi was named after Arun Jaitley. The same criteria may apply there too. People are asking these questions."

Saamana wrote, "Indira Gandhi was assassinated by terrorists. Rajiv Gandhi also lost his life in a terrorist attack. There may be differences of opinion with him. Differences have a place in a democracy, but the sacrifices of both the Prime Ministers, who made this mistake." Contributed a lot to the progress of the country, cannot be made fun of."

He further wrote, "Renaming the Rajiv Gandhi Khel Ratna Award as Major Dhyan Chand Khel Ratna Award is a political game, not a public sentiment."
